What are the BENEFITS of a boxing fitness class?

Boxing helps you burn fat and tone muscle in a short amount of time – you’ll gain a firm butt, a smaller waist, toned arms & a lean sexy body.   Boxing fitness classes are a great cardiovascular workout for weight loss, stronger heart and lungs, increased bone density, reduced stress, reduced risk of heart disease and some types of cancer, temporary relief from depression and anxiety, and better sleep. Boxing releases aggression and manage your stress by getting your endorphins pumping.

What can I expect at a group class?

To have fun in a family oriented atmosphere!

Class is a well-balanced workout consisting of boxing fitness, cardio training and functional fitness.  It is a full body workout  – legs, core, back, shoulders, and arms.

You’ll be doing conditioning drills like jumping jacks, sit ups, and quick feet drills as well as fundamental boxing including mitt work and bag work.

Before class begins we’ll wrap your hands to protect them and get you in a pair of real boxing gloves.

Do I need to bring my own wraps and gloves to class?

We have gloves that you can rent during classes.

We do ask that you bring your own pair of wraps for classes, we sell them here at the gym or you can purchase them elsewhere. If you purchase them elsewhere, we recommend purchasing a pair that is 180″ long and has a bit of elastic in it.
